Output fae52d4078419e76f855f2dd672578b94aa1746d739f7685cda04eef13cb6e53:20

value
129525
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d0a3b9103baabd2f20aea633c56bf7882461bd8b6a2cfb89fc3a15abe78fe7f
address
bc1pm59rhygrh24a9us2af3nc44l0zpyvx7ck63vlwylcws440nclelsadg94a
transaction
fae52d4078419e76f855f2dd672578b94aa1746d739f7685cda04eef13cb6e53
spent
true